Mix up a batch of epoxy and spread it on the parts of, in this case, a wood bench that come in contact with the ground—especially end-grain pieces. Extend the life of your outdoor furniture, planters and other items made of wood with this simple tip: Mix up a batch of epoxy ... WebNov 4, 2024 · They will hungrily wick up water when furniture feet stand on wet ground. That can create excess swelling and can contribute to premature rot and cracking.
